Frequently Asked Questions about Cutler Bay
How much are Studio apartments in Cutler Bay?
There are currently 23 Studio Apartments in Cutler Bay with rent ranges from $1,200 to $4,750 with an average price of $1,862.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Cutler Bay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Cutler Bay ranges from $1,091 to $4,190 with an average monthly rent of $1,893.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Cutler Bay c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Cutler Bay range from $1,250 to $4,064.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,444.
How expensive are Cutler Bay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 51 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Cutler Bay on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,833 to $4,225 - averaging $2,863 for the location.
